Benefits of Shackle

 

Versatility and Ease of Use
Shackles are highly versatile, available in various sizes and load capacities, making them suitable for many applications. They are used to connect ropes, chains, and cables to lifting devices, ensuring safety and efficiency during operations. Additionally, they do not require special tools for assembly, making it easy to connect and disconnect loads. This offers a simple and convenient solution for rigging and lifting applications.

 

Corrosion Resistance
In harsh environments like maritime operations, shackles can be coated with corrosion-resistant materials. This makes them ideal for use in conditions where exposure to saltwater and other corrosive elements is a concern. The corrosion-resistant coatings enhance their durability and longevity, ensuring they maintain their structural integrity and reliability even in challenging conditions.

 

Load Capacity and Strength
Their robust construction ensures a durable and secure attachment, making shackles indispensable tools in industrial and construction settings, especially for heavy loads and high tension. They are suitable for applications involving substantial loads and long-term or permanent connections, providing exceptional strength and load capacity.

Types of Shackle
 

Anchor and Bow Shackles
These crane shackles are called anchor or bow shackles due to their large “O” shaped bow. This bow design gives them the ability to be used in multi sling configurations as well as the ability to be side loaded (with some reduction in working load limit). Although the term bow and anchor shackle are used interchangeably, a true bow shackle has a larger and more defined “O” shaped bow than an anchor shackle.

 

Chain and D Shackles
These crane shackles are called chain or D shackles because of their “D” shaped bow. Chain shackles have narrower bows than anchor and bow shackles. This bow design gives D shackles the ability to carry extremely heavy loads in an in-line position. Unlike anchor and bow shackles, chain and D shackles should never be side loaded, as they are designed and rated for in-line tension only.

 

Bolt Type Shackles
Bolt type shackles, sometimes referred to as bolt and nut cotter shackles or safety shackles are lifting shackles with a pin that is secured using a bolt, nut and cotter. They are called safety shackles because they offer industry leading safety and securement when it comes to lifting shackles.

 

Round Pin Shackles
Round pin shackles are constructed using a round, unthreaded pin that is secured by a cotter. Round pin shackles are ideal for applications where the shackle may be subjected to twisting or torquing, since rotating motions cannot dislodge the pin. Round pin shackles are not as secure as bolt or screw pin type shackles and are therefore not to be used for overhead lifting.

Synthetic Sling Shackles
Synthetic slings require special shackles because they tend to pinch and bunch in regular shackles. This bunching and pinching can severely reduce a synthetic sling’s working load limit. Synthetic sling shackles have an extra wide and flat bow which increases the bearing surface on the bow and sling.

 

Wide Body Shackles
Wide body shackles have a standard “O” shaped bow that is even bigger and wider than traditional anchor shackles. Wide body shackles are useful for rigging synthetic round and web slings and especially for rigging wire rope slings. Shackles used in wire rope sling rigging must have a diameter that is greater than or equal to the diameter of the wire rope. This is called the D/d ratio.

 

Long Reach Shackles
Long reach shackles are ideal for applications in the construction industry where a longer reach is needed to attach to pick points. Just like D ring shackles, long reach shackles should never be side or point loaded. To achieve the full working load limit, the load should be evenly distributed over the entire pin. Long reach shackles can additionally be used as a bail for lifting thicker objects.

 

Sheet Pile Shackles
Sheet pile shackles are made specifically for pulling sheet piling. They are equipped with a with an easy opening pin which does not detach from the shackle. While sheet pile shackles are limited in their scope of use, they perform their specific job extraordinarily well.

Application of Shackle

 

 

Construction and Infrastructure
Shackles play a crucial role in construction projects, from lifting steel beams to securing heavy machinery. They provide a secure connection point for cables, slings, and other rigging equipment, ensuring safe and precise lifting.

 

Maritime Operations
In the maritime industry, shackles are used to hoist and secure cargo containers, anchor chains, and heavy maritime equipment. Their corrosion-resistant properties make them suitable for the harsh marine environment.

 

Offshore Oil and Gas
Shackles are vital in offshore operations, such as lifting and positioning drilling equipment, subsea structures, and pipelines. Their durability and load-bearing capacity are essential for maintaining safety standards in challenging conditions.

 

Agriculture and Farming
Shackles find utility in the agricultural sector for tasks like moving large bales of hay, positioning irrigation equipment, and even assisting in livestock handling systems.

 

Automotive and Manufacturing
Within manufacturing facilities, shackles aid in the movement of heavy machinery during assembly or maintenance. They're also used to lift vehicle engines and components in the automotive industry.

FAQ

Q: What is the meaning of a shackle?

A: A shackle looks like a letter U and is used for lifting and securing items. It has a bolt or screw pin to hold things together.

Q: What materials are shackles made from?

A: Shackles can be made of stainless steel for the sea because it resists rust. For very strong needs, they use alloy steels.

Q: What are the key safety considerations when using shackles?

A: It's important to choose the right shackle for the job and its conditions. Always follow the weight limit. Check shackles often for wear. Replace them if they're damaged. Using shackles properly keeps things safe.

Q: How do you determine the appropriate shackle for a specific task?

A: To pick the right shackle, look at the load and how its direction. Consider if it needs to resist rust. Make sure the shackle you choose fits the task. This is crucial for safety and success.

Q: What is the difference between a standard shackle and a high-capacity shackle?

A: High-capacity shackles are designed to accommodate heavier loads than standard shackles and typically have a larger WLL and safety factor.

Q: How should a shackle be stored when not in use?

A: A shackle should be stored in a clean, dry, and corrosion-free environment when not in use. It's recommended to coat the shackle with a rust inhibitor or lubricant to prevent the pin from seizing or the body from rusting.

Q: How are shackles cleaned and maintained?

A: Shackles should be cleaned with a wire brush to remove any dirt or debris before storing them. They should also be lubricated with a suitable oil or grease to prevent rust and corrosion.
